Protection : More than 1 range protected ??
 
I want to set up protection on a worksheet, but when I try to add the range/s of cells I get to an amount, then it resets itself. I am assuming this is the maximum limit of cells for the range.
If I create a 2nd and 3rd range, is it possible to set to default all 3 ranges when the workbook is opened?
How ?

My aim is to enable ONLY the selected range of cells to able to have data entered/removed.
All other cells are NOT available.
BUT,, there's more....

I need the code for emailing a layout in a email body to STILL be available to the user.
The worksheet has numerous formulas and references to other cells, and I do not want these to be modified.

Possible?

Corey,
I suspect that in moving from range to range you're releasing the [shift] or
[ctrl] key which is resetting your selection.

Remember that you don't have to select all of the cells you want to protect
at the same time to protect them. You can select them in groups. I find
this sometimes takes the frustration out of protecting cells that are widely
separated on a large sheet.

To select cells that are spread around a sheet, hold down the [Ctrl] key
while selecting them. You can then use Format to set the Locked state for
all currently selected. The problem comes when you go to select another cell
and accidentally release the [Ctrl] key - all the previously selected cells
become unselected.
